Output 66fd7017816935a48c27f8adcd0dfa5060453205d382cc685347df84c234f270:0

value
611000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50063c84783c6a0298cfabf274239fc6193f8d3 OP_EQUAL
address
3M7GKV81ZTYGAtXESrsayfDXWRj59kixTf
transaction
66fd7017816935a48c27f8adcd0dfa5060453205d382cc685347df84c234f270